The lifestyle around you
n
Cannington is around 12 km south of Perth's CBD, with easy access to public transport and major roads. It's a convenient base with plenty nearby, plus green spaces like Canning River Regional Park for the kind of weekends that reset you.

Registration requirements
n
To be eligible, you'll need a Veterinary Science qualification recognised by the Australasian Veterinary Boards Council (AVBC) and/or completion of NAVLE, AVE or equivalent pathways.
